Simon Wilby Charges on to a Charger Free Future

There seems to be no stopping Simon Wilby from coming up with more and more uses for solar power. After the tremendous success in developing The Smart One, an aftermarket product for cellular phones which practically eliminates the need to lug around a conventional charger, Simon Wilby is set to take on more ambitious projects using the same design principles behind The Smart One.

Simon Wilby has already patented and designed a similar product for laptops that could spell the end for those bulky chargers consumers are forced to lug around.

Other Simon Wilby solar powered devices to soon to hit shelves include ‘smart batteries’ which would eliminate the need to replace dead batteries on important household devices like smoke and carbon monoxide detectors.

Simon Wilby even plans to apply this technology in developing solar powered street lamps to light remote areas of the island nation of Barbados, where his company The Smart Power Inc. is based.
